首页 > 资讯
制作拼接app(拼接乐APP,简单好玩的拼图游戏)
来源:本凡南京 阅读:192 时间:2023/11/11

摘要:

制作拼接app是一种让用户可以轻松拼接图片、视频和音频等媒体资源的应用程序。本文将从四个方面详细介绍制作拼接app的方法和技巧,包括功能设计、界面设计、算法选择和用户体验优化。通过深入探讨这些方面的内容,读者将对制作拼接app有更全面的认识和理解。

一、功能设计

1、核心功能

一个优秀的拼接app需要具备核心的图片、视频和音频拼接功能。在设计拼接功能时,需要考虑到如何方便用户拼接不同格式、不同尺寸和不同质量的媒体资源,以及如何进行精确的时间轴控制。

2、辅助功能

除了基本的拼接功能外,拼接app还可以提供一些辅助功能来增加用户的使用体验。例如,可以添加特效和滤镜功能,让用户可以为拼接的媒体资源添加个性化的效果;还可以提供剪辑和裁剪功能,让用户可以精确地调整拼接结果的长度和尺寸。

3、导出和分享功能

拼接app最终的目标是让用户可以将拼接好的作品导出和分享。因此,在功能设计中需要考虑到如何让用户方便地导出和分享拼接的作品。可以提供不同格式和不同分辨率的导出选项,并支持直接分享到社交媒体平台和云存储服务。

二、界面设计

1、简洁直观

拼接app的界面设计应该简洁直观,让用户能够迅速上手。可以采用扁平化的设计风格,减少过多的视觉元素和冗余的功能按钮。同时,可以使用图标和标签来提高用户对功能的识别和理解。

2、易于操作

界面上的操作控件应该易于触摸和拖拽,以适应手机和平板电脑等触控设备的特点。可以提供拖拽排序和缩放功能,让用户可以方便地调整拼接结果的顺序和大小。还可以提供撤销和重做功能,以便用户可以随时调整和修改拼接的效果。

3、可定制性

界面设计还应该考虑到用户的个性化需求。可以提供不同的主题和配色方案,让用户可以根据自己的喜好来进行界面定制。还可以提供可拖拽、可隐藏的功能按钮,让用户可以根据自己的需要来调整界面布局和控件的显示。

三、算法选择

1、图像处理算法

在拼接app中,图像处理算法起着至关重要的作用。例如,在拼接图片时,可以使用图像分割、特征匹配和图像融合等算法来提高拼接的质量和效果。而在拼接视频时,可以使用帧间插值和运动补偿等算法来提高视频的流畅度和连贯性。

2、音频处理算法

如果拼接的媒体资源中包含音频,那么需要选择合适的音频处理算法来提高音频的质量和效果。例如,可以使用降噪、均衡器和混响等算法来增强音频的清晰度、音质和环境感。

3、性能优化算法

在拼接大量的媒体资源时,需要考虑到性能的优化。可以使用多线程和分布式计算等算法来加快拼接的速度和提高系统的稳定性。还可以使用缓存和压缩等算法来减少内存和存储的占用,提高拼接app的响应速度和用户体验。

四、用户体验优化

1、引导和教育

拼接app在用户初次使用时,可以通过引导和教育来帮助用户了解和掌握主要功能。可以使用引导页面和视频教程来展示拼接的步骤和操作方法,并提供实时的帮助和提示。

2、反馈和建议

用户在使用拼接app时,可能会遇到各种问题和困惑。拼接app应该提供反馈和建议的渠道,让用户可以随时反馈问题和提出建议。可以通过内置的反馈功能和社交媒体平台来收集用户的反馈和建议,并及时回复和解决用户的问题。

3、稳定和安全

拼接app应该保持稳定和安全的运行。要做到这一点,需要进行充分的测试和优化,确保拼接app在各种设备上的兼容性和稳定性。还需要保护用户的隐私和数据安全,防止用户的个人信息和作品被非法获取和使用。

五、总结:

综上所述,制作拼接app需要从功能设计、界面设计、算法选择和用户体验优化四个方面进行全面考虑。只有在各个方面都做到合理设计和优化,才能够制作出用户满意的拼接app。希望本文的介绍和分析能够对读者在制作拼接app方面提供一些有益的启示和参考,鼓励读者在这个领域进行更多的研究和探索。